Austin, TX: University of Texas Press , 1997. First American Edition (Cohen A297). Hardcover (with Dust Jacket). Very Good. 8vo (397 pages). A fascinating epistolary chronicle of business and friendship between the enterprising owner of the independent press service known as Cooperation and his favorite writer/client, Winston Churchill. Emery Reves forcefully placed Churchill’s pro-democracy articles in newspapers around the world during the years leading up to World War II, then acted as his agent following the war negotiating the publication of Churchill’s war memoirs and his History of the English-Speaking Peoples.
